Novel Study Grouping Suggestions

These groupings are just suggestions.  Many combinations are possible and equally desirable.  The numbers in parentheses next to the headings are Barbara's recommended grade levels.  Reading level designation remains extremely subjective, causing even the experts to disagree.  Our grade level suggestions are based on a combination of reading level, maturity, content, and level of thinking required by the study.  You are strongly encouraged to make up your own set.   Usually three to five books are studied during the course of a school year.
